4.5.11 Measuring diluted samples

If the concentration of a test sample exceeds the measuring range of a
method, you can dilute the sample by a factor 1 ... 99 so that the con-
centration of the diluted test sample is within the measuring range of
the method (see photometry analysis manual). Thus a valid measure-
ment is possible.
After entering the factor for the dilution the meter converts the concen-
tration to that of the undiluted sample.
The display then indicates the measured value of the undiluted sample.
1
Select the program for which a dilution factor is to be entered.
2
Open the Configuration / Photometry / Dilution menu.
The current factor of the dilution is displayed.

3
Open the display for the entry of numerals with <START/EN-
TER>.
4
Enter the factor of the dilution with the number keys.
The factor has to be a whole number between 0 ... 99.
5
Confirm the factor with <START/ENTER>.
6
Exit the Dilution menu with <ESC>.
For the following measurements with the selected program, the
concentration of the undiluted sampled is displayed as the
measurement result.
The entered dilution factor is only valid for the selected program. The
dilution factor is erased if:
 the meter is switched off
 a different program number is selected
 the factor 0 is entered in the Dilution menu.
If a dilution factor is active, it is indicated on the display during measure-
ment in the form [x + 1].
